Claims (9)
- 入力される、2以上のオーディオチャネルの1以上のダウンミックスオーディオ入力チャネルと前記1以上のダウンミックスオーディオ入力チャネルのアップミックスのための空間パラメータとを利用して、両耳出力チャネルの対を生成するための空間デコーダユニットであって、
パラメータ化された知覚伝達関数を利用して、パラメータドメインで前記空間パラメータを両耳パラメータへと変換するためのパラメータ変換ユニットであって、前記両耳パラメータは、前記パラメータ化された知覚伝達関数及び前記空間パラメータの双方に依存する、パラメータ変換ユニットと、
前記1以上のダウンミックスオーディオ入力チャネルを、QMFドメインのオーディオ信号の対に変換する変換手段と、
QMFドメインの両耳チャネルLb及びRbの対を、
前記QMFドメインの両耳チャネルの対を、前記両耳出力チャネルの対へと逆変換するための逆変換手段と、
を有し、
前記両耳パラメータは、
- 前記パラメータ変換ユニットは、チャネルレベル、チャネルコヒーレンス、チャネル予測及び/又は位相パラメータを処理するように構成された、請求項1に記載の空間デコーダユニット。
- 前記変換手段が、該1つのダウンミックスオーディオ入力チャネルをQMFドメインの1つのオーディオ信号に変換する変換ユニットと、該1つのオーディオ信号の非相関化されたバージョンを生成するための非相関ユニットとを含み、該1つのオーディオ信号及び該非相関化されたバージョンが、前記QMFドメインのオーディオ信号の対を構成する、請求項1又は2に記載の空間デコーダユニット。
- 時間ドメインで動作するように構成されたステレオ反響ユニットを更に有する、請求項1から3いずれか1項に記載の空間デコーダユニット。
- QMFドメインにおいて動作するように構成されたステレオ反響ユニットを更に有する、請求項1から3いずれか1項に記載の空間デコーダユニット。
- 請求項1から5いずれか1項に記載の空間デコーダユニットを有する、オーディオシステム。
- 請求項1から5いずれか1項に記載の空間デコーダユニットを有する、消費者向け装置。
- 入力される、2以上のオーディオチャネルの1以上のダウンミックスオーディオ入力チャネルと前記1以上のダウンミックスオーディオ入力チャネルのアップミックスのための空間パラメータとを利用して、両耳出力チャネルの対を生成する方法であって、
パラメータ化された知覚伝達関数を利用して、パラメータドメインで前記空間パラメータを両耳パラメータへと変換するステップであって、前記両耳パラメータは、前記パラメータ化された知覚伝達関数及び前記空間パラメータの双方に依存する、ステップと、
前記1以上のダウンミックスオーディオ入力チャネルを、QMFドメインのオーディオ信号の対に変換するステップと、
QMFドメインの両耳チャネルLb及びRbの対を、
前記QMFドメインの両耳チャネルの対を、前記両耳出力チャネルの対へと逆変換するステップと、
を有し、
前記両耳パラメータは、
- 請求項8に記載の方法を実行するためのコンピュータプログラム。
